Veteran poker pro Shannon Shorr has added to his long list of poker accomplishments by taking down Event #2 of the PokerGO Tour Last Chance series to earn $297,500. Shorr came from well back as Day 2 action began to ultimately win the largest-ever $10K event in PGT history.

Event #2, the second of six $10,100 no-limit hold'em events on the Last Chance slate, drew in a record 119 entries for a PGT $10K tourney, with Shorr's nearly-$300,000 being the winner's share of the resulting $1.19 million prize pool.

Shorr topped Joe Serock in a heads-up duel that began with the players nearly even but lasted just two hands. With short stacks in play, the two got the chips in with Shorr holding A-6 and in a virtual race against Serock's pocket fives. The flop brought two aces and no five appeared, sealing Shorr's come-from-behind win.

The day could have been extremely short for Shorr as it was, as he won another flip against start-of-day chip leader Stephen Song, who ultimately faded to a fourth-place finish. Shorr got his short stack in with pocket jacks against Song's A-K, but Song couldn't improve, and the double-up paved the way for Shorr's run to the win.
